First, we lost Polo Field, and now due to the layoffs we’ve lost four more of Club Penguin’s bloggers: Daffodaily5 from the English blog, Karlapop321 from the Spanish blog, Koa Koralle from the German blog, and Loustik005 from the French blog. To go out with a bang the four will be having a party tomorrow, the 3rd of June, at 8:00 AM PST. (11:00 AM EST/4:00 PM BST)
